Java 문법 종합 3주차 강의를 쪼개서 듣고,
코드 작성하는게 아직 익숙지 않아서 프로그래머스에서 코딩테스트를 몇 문제 풀어보았다.
자바가 대표적인 객체지향 언어라는 것,
클래스 설계와 객체 생성, 인스턴스화,
필드와 메서드,
매개변수의 종류(기본형, 참조형),
멤버(인스턴스 멤버, 클래스 멤버),
지역변수와 상수,
생성자 this,
접근제어자,
getter와 setter,
import와 package,
상속관계와 포함관계,
overriding와 super,
다형성과 instance of 까지
3주차 강의에서 이해가지 않는 부분까지 3개의 단편으로 쪼개서 2번씩 반복해서 들었다.
그동안 코드 따라 치면서 왜 쓰는거지? 궁금했던 점들이 풀려서 나름 즐겁게 들을 수 있었다.
근데 나보고 코드 작성하라고 하면,,, 잘 안될 것 같다. 개념을 숙지하는거랑 기출문제 푸는 거랑은 큰 간격이 있달까...?
오늘은 강의 듣고, 코테 몇개 해본다고 시간이 금방 흘렀다. 3일차가 되니 집중력도 떨어지고 머리 속에 잘 들어오고 있는지 의문이다. 오늘은 어제보다 3시간 덜 공부해서 음. . . .